Output 21d08683ad18220290f437703a8f6954db0fbaa5ad639eb92540f5f09b813609:0

value
137220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87fe71110ea361bec794887f32653099fffaa5ac OP_EQUAL
address
3E65xMhqLs7WrE1bRz96jzYm6siQ9EiKeP
transaction
21d08683ad18220290f437703a8f6954db0fbaa5ad639eb92540f5f09b813609
spent
true